About This Data

This page shows how Rolls-Royce Dawn cars manufactured in 2016 perform at MOT as they age. Data spans from 2019 to 2024, covering 859 tests. Pass rates naturally decline with age as components wear.

Based on DVSA anonymised MOT test data (2005–2024). Crown copyright, Open Government Licence v3.0.
